Here's a follow-up on my previous post here:

I'm 64, had an MI in 1991..About 8 months ago I went on the Atkins regimen. Because of my history, I was leery of the Cholesteral levels that Atkins might bring.

I had a lipid profile done last week and here are the results.

total cholesteral......148
HDL....................53
LDLD..................78.7
Triglycerides.........89

HDL ratio.............2.8

Needless to say, I am happy with these numbers..they are the best ones so far in 13 years.

Since losing the weight that I wanted to, I've migrated to a more Southbeach regimen..Less fat, more veggies and fruit, BUT very little white bread, pasta, do-nuts etc.
